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Peel and finely chop the onion. Heat the olive oil in a small skillet over medium heat. Add the onion and cook, stirring frequently, until caramelized and golden brown (about 8-10 minutes). Set aside to cool.
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t, and cracked black pepper.
Cut the cold unsalted butter into small cubes and add it to the dry ingredients. Using a pastry cutter or your fingers, work the butter into the flour until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
Add the cooled caramelized onion and shredded cheddar cheese to the flour mixture. Stir gently to distribute evenly.
In a small bowl, whisk together the milk and egg.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ients, reserving about 1 tablespoon of the liquid to brush on the scones later.
Stir the mixture gently until a soft dough forms.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ead it a few times until it comes together.
Shape the dough into a 1-inch-thick circle. Cut the circle into 8 equal wedges using a sharp knife. Transfer the wedges to the prepared baking sheet, spacing them slightly apart.
Brush the tops of the scones with the reserved milk and egg mixture. Sprinkle a little extra cracked black pepper on top, if desired.
Bake the scones in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until golden brown and cooked through.
Remove the scones from the oven and let them cool slightly on the baking sheet before serving. Enjoy warm or at room temperature.
